数据库sa为什么登不进

fiy 其他 19

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库sa无法登录可能有以下几个原因:

    1. 密码错误:检查sa账户的密码是否正确输入。如果不确定密码是否正确,可以尝试重置密码。

    2. 账户被锁定:如果连续多次输入错误密码,数据库可能会自动锁定sa账户。可以通过管理员账户解锁sa账户或者等待一段时间后重新尝试登录。

    3. SQL Server服务未启动:检查SQL Server服务是否已经启动。如果服务未启动,sa账户将无法登录。

    4. 登录权限限制:检查sa账户是否被限制登录。可以通过检查数据库的安全设置或者登录属性来确认是否有限制。

    5. 网络连接问题:如果服务器与数据库之间存在网络连接问题,可能导致sa账户无法登录。可以检查网络连接是否正常,尝试使用其他工具或者从其他机器尝试登录sa账户。

    如果以上方法都无法解决问题,可能需要进一步排查数据库配置、权限设置等方面的问题,或者联系数据库管理员或技术支持人员寻求帮助。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库sa账户无法登录可能有以下几种原因:

    1. 密码错误:sa账户的密码输入错误是最常见的原因之一。确保输入的密码是正确的,并且区分大小写。如果不确定密码是否正确,可以尝试重置sa账户的密码。

    2. 登录限制:sa账户可能被设置了登录限制,如只允许在特定的IP地址或特定的时间段登录。检查数据库的登录限制设置,确保sa账户没有被限制。

    3. 账户锁定:如果连续多次尝试登录失败,sa账户可能会被锁定。这是为了防止暴力破解密码。在这种情况下,需要解锁sa账户才能再次登录。可以通过以下命令解锁sa账户:
      ALTER LOGIN sa WITH PASSWORD = '新密码' UNLOCK

    4. SQL Server服务未启动:如果SQL Server服务未启动,sa账户将无法登录。确保SQL Server服务已经正确启动。可以在服务管理器中检查SQL Server服务的状态。

    5. 权限问题:如果sa账户没有足够的权限登录数据库,则也无法成功登录。确保sa账户具有足够的权限,包括登录权限和访问所需的数据库权限。

    6. 连接字符串错误:如果在连接数据库时使用了错误的连接字符串,也会导致登录失败。检查连接字符串是否正确,并确保包含正确的服务器名称、数据库名称和sa账户的凭据信息。

    如果以上方法都无法解决问题,可能需要进一步检查数据库的配置和日志文件,以确定导致sa账户无法登录的原因。可以查看SQL Server的错误日志以及相关的系统事件日志,以获取更多的错误信息和提示。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库sa无法登录的原因可能有多种,下面是一些常见的问题和解决方法:

    1. 密码错误:确保输入的密码是正确的。注意密码区分大小写。如果忘记了密码,可以使用SQL Server的“忘记密码”功能进行重置密码。

    2. 登录权限问题:确保sa账户具有足够的登录权限。在SQL Server Management Studio中,右键点击服务器,选择“属性”,然后选择“安全性”选项卡,在“服务器身份验证”部分选择“SQL Server和Windows身份验证模式”,确保“sa”账户已启用。

    3. SQL Server服务未启动:确保SQL Server服务已经启动。可以在Windows服务中查看SQL Server服务的状态。如果服务未启动,右键点击服务,选择“启动”。

    4. 防火墙问题:防火墙可能阻止了与SQL Server的连接。确保SQL Server的监听端口已经在防火墙规则中开放。可以尝试暂时关闭防火墙,然后再次尝试登录。

    5. 登录名被锁定:如果多次尝试登录失败,SQL Server会锁定登录名一段时间。可以等待一段时间后再尝试登录,或者通过其他具有管理员权限的账户解锁sa账户。

    6. SQL Server实例名称错误:如果使用了命名实例,确保在连接字符串中正确指定了实例名称。可以使用“计算机名称\实例名称”的格式。

    7. 其他网络问题:如果是通过网络连接到SQL Server,可能存在网络问题导致无法连接。可以尝试使用其他工具(如telnet)测试与SQL Server的连接。

    如果以上方法都无法解决问题,建议检查SQL Server的错误日志和Windows事件日志,查找更详细的错误信息,或者联系数据库管理员寻求帮助。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部